The average house sale price in Canals hit $612,682 this month - up 6.6% from last month. That's a real jump. But here's the nuance: homes are selling at 96.37% of list price, which means buyers are still negotiating a bit of room off the asking price. We're not in a bidding-war frenzy, but we're not in a fire-sale market either.
Houses are sitting on the market for about 33 days on average. Compare that to Sagewood at 47 days, and it's clear that Canals is moving faster than most of our neighbours. When a home sells quicker, sellers hold more of the power at the table.
On the rental side, a 5.46% yield is genuinely strong. If you own a house in Canals and you're thinking about renting it out instead of selling, the numbers actually support that conversation.
The condo story in Canals is less dramatic, but it's not bad news. The average sale price is sitting at $322,000, essentially flat month over month. Condos are selling at 99.42% of list price - meaning sellers are getting almost exactly what they ask for. That's a stable, predictable market.
Only 2 condos sold this period, so we're working with a small sample. But those units moved in 32 days, faster than Sagewood's 47-day average. Canals condos are still a quicker sell than most comparable spots nearby.
The 4.14% rental yield is moderate - not a home run, but not a reason to panic either. If you own a condo here, it's a hold, not a run-for-the-exits situation.

If you own a house in Canals and you've been on the fence about selling, the timing is genuinely interesting right now. Prices are up month over month, homes are moving faster than most nearby neighbourhoods, and buyers are still active. You're not going to get a bidding war necessarily, but you're also not going to sit on the market for two months.
The gap between the average list price ($669,600) and the average sale price ($612,682) tells you something important: pricing your home right from day one matters. Overpricing it chases buyers away. Price it sharp, and Canals buyers are ready to move.
For condo owners, summer is a reasonable time to test the market. The sale-to-list ratio of 99.42% means buyers aren't lowballing - they're paying close to asking. But with only 2 sales in the recent period, you'll want to watch inventory closely. A well-presented unit at the right price can stand out quickly in a thin market.
